    In Europe, either, no Portugal ETF... !!! ???

    That's all I,ve found :

    Portugal: One of the only euro zone members without its own ETF, Portugal is 

    accessible in minor amounts through broad-based Europe ETFs like IEV and VGK.

    iShares S&P Europe 350 Index ETF (IEV)

    Vanguard European Stock VIPERs ETF (VGK)

    Portugal Telecom - PT - is the only Portuguese company stock besides pink sheets trading in the U.S. I could find with several searches on Google and Yahoo.  Ishares doesn't have a ticker for a Portugal country ETF, but saw and then lost an article that said EWP - the Ishares Spain ETF, was being taken down with Portugal.  Another company came out with a very new ETF LIS, guessing it has to do with the capital Lisbon, but there is no, as in zero volume so far. 

    So that's the only choices, PT, but they also have telecom service in Africa and Brazil, so not sure how much of a straight Portugal play that is, and EWP, which may be better, because they (Spain) also have problems, and is related/affiliated with Portugal more than most anything else.
